問題現(xiàn)象
許多WordPress網(wǎng)站管理員近期報告稱,他們的網(wǎng)站突然出現(xiàn)了大量無效頁面(404錯誤頁面)。這些頁面通常包含隨機字符組合或看似無意義的URL結(jié)構(gòu),導致網(wǎng)站出現(xiàn)以下問題:
- 搜索引擎收錄質(zhì)量下降
- 網(wǎng)站統(tǒng)計數(shù)據(jù)分析失真
- 服務器資源被無效請求占用
- 用戶體驗受到影響
可能原因分析
1. 插件沖突或漏洞
某些WordPress插件可能存在安全漏洞或代碼缺陷,導致自動生成無效URL或開放了不應存在的訪問路徑。
2. 主題功能異常
定制主題或某些功能豐富的主題可能包含錯誤的重寫規(guī)則,意外創(chuàng)建了無效的頁面路徑。
3. 惡意掃描或攻擊
黑客可能利用掃描工具探測網(wǎng)站漏洞,產(chǎn)生大量無效請求,這些請求會被記錄為404錯誤。
4. 搜索引擎爬蟲異常
某些搜索引擎爬蟲可能錯誤地索引了不存在的URL,導致后續(xù)大量爬取無效頁面。
5. 數(shù)據(jù)庫損壞
WordPress數(shù)據(jù)庫表(特別是wp_posts和wp_postmeta)可能出現(xiàn)損壞或異常,導致系統(tǒng)生成錯誤鏈接。
解決方案
1. 檢查并更新插件/主題
- 停用所有插件,然后逐一重新激活,找出問題插件
- 更新所有插件和主題至最新版本
- 刪除不再使用或來源不明的插件
2. 配置正確的重定向
- 在.htaccess文件中設置301重定向規(guī)則
- 使用Redirection等專業(yè)插件管理404錯誤
- 設置規(guī)范的404錯誤頁面,引導用戶返回有效內(nèi)容
3. 加強網(wǎng)站安全防護
- 安裝安全插件如Wordfence或Sucuri
- 限制XML-RPC訪問
- 設置合理的訪問頻率限制
4. 優(yōu)化搜索引擎索引
- 通過Google Search Console提交404錯誤頁面
- 更新網(wǎng)站sitemap.xml文件
- 使用robots.txt阻止爬蟲訪問無效路徑
5. 數(shù)據(jù)庫維護
- 使用WP-Optimize等工具優(yōu)化數(shù)據(jù)庫
- 檢查并修復損壞的數(shù)據(jù)表
- 清理無效的postmeta記錄
預防措施
- 定期備份網(wǎng)站數(shù)據(jù)和數(shù)據(jù)庫
- 啟用網(wǎng)站監(jiān)控服務,及時發(fā)現(xiàn)異常
- 保持WordPress核心、插件和主題的及時更新
- 使用可靠的托管服務,確保服務器環(huán)境安全
- 定期審核網(wǎng)站鏈接結(jié)構(gòu),確保URL一致性
通過以上措施,大多數(shù)WordPress網(wǎng)站可以有效解決大量無效頁面問題,恢復網(wǎng)站健康狀態(tài),提升用戶體驗和搜索引擎表現(xiàn)。